Role Summary

We’re seeking an experienced and ambitious finance professional to join our Business Finance team supporting Ramboll Germany. As our new Project Controller (m/f/d) you will work with the project team to deliver solutions to our clients, be part of the Henning & Larsen department in Germany, and collaborate with colleagues across a vibrant, innovative, international, and supportive team. You’ll play a critical role in defining and delivering projects that involve global clients and help close the gap to a sustainable future.

Key Responsibilities
  • Proactively manage the financial performance of your project portfolio, driving value through revenue recognition, risk management, working‑capital optimisation, and project monitoring.
  • Champion financial governance by ensuring compliance with project accounting standards, internal controls, Rambol’s policies and procedures, tax, statutory, and audit requirements.
  • Responsible for project set‑up and ongoing maintenance.
  • Contribute to the continuous improvement of Rambol’s financial processes and systems.
  • Provide financial advice to stakeholders, identifying risks and opportunities early and offering practical, data‑driven solutions (including participation in tender reviews).
  • Apply an innovative mindset to streamline and enhance financial operations.
  • Support change initiatives with agility, helping teams adapt to evolving business priorities.
  • Build strong collaborative relationships with Business Controllers, Project Managers, and senior leadership.
  • Partner with our India‑based support team to ensure timely and accurate project maintenance and billing.

Work at the Heart of Sustainable Change with Ramboll

Ramboll is a global architecture, engineering, and consultancy company. As a foundation‑owned people company founded in Denmark, we believe that the purpose of sustainable change is to create a thriving world for both nature and people. Our history is rooted in a clear vision of how a responsible company should act, and being open and curious is a cornerstone of our culture. Ramboll employs more than 18,000 people globally across 35 countries. Ramboll experts deliver innovative solutions across Buildings, Transport, Water, Environment & Health, Energy Management, Consulting, and Architecture & Landscape. By combining local experience with global knowledge, we help shape the societies of tomorrow.
